Astana Hub
Astana Hub is a technology park and innovation cluster in Kazakhstan, established to support the growth of the tech ecosystem in Central Eurasia. It connects entrepreneurs, businesses, and investors to foster innovative projects.

Portfolio context
Astana Hub has a diverse portfolio of over 1,800 local and international companies. Notable achievements include raising $612 million in investments and generating a total revenue of ₸864 billion from its participants over five years.

Community activity
Events and activity
Astana Hub organizes various events, including hackathons, pitch days, and technology forums. Notable events include Demo Day, where participants of the Silkway Accelerator pitch their startups to investors, and the Bilim Shańyraǵy Hackathon, an EdTech hackathon for pitching educational technology solutions.
